Galmed Issues CEO Letter to Shareholders
Rhea-AI Summary
Galmed (Nasdaq: GLMD) issued a CEO letter on Dec 1, 2025 outlining clinical and financial progress for Aramchol. The company reported approx. $19.2 million cash at the end of Q3 2025 and a reported burn of ~$1.5M per quarter. Galmed highlighted Phase 3 ARMOR open‑label results showing fibrosis improvement at week 48: 65% (paired) and 100% (AI). The company is developing new sublingual and subcutaneous formulations, plans a Phase 2 MASH trial and intends to start a Phase 1/2 oncology trial with VCU in early 2026. Management emphasized disciplined capital use and continued clinical expansion of Aramchol.

In the aftermath of the COVID 19 pandemic, we announced the discontinuation of ARMOR study. Yet, contrary to most cases where clinical studies are prematurely stopped, normally due to safety signals or lack of efficacy, in our case, it was neither. Aramchol is a potent anti-fibrotic compound with excellent safety and tolerability with a solid scientific and clinical basis.
Like other complex diseases, it is now understood that monotherapies can only have limited mild to moderate efficacy. Addressing all aspects of MASH i.e. inflammation, liver fat infiltration and fibrosis demand the combination of drugs with more than one mechanism of action (MoA). Following the first wave of the development of monotherapy treatments, combination therapy of drugs with synergetic MoAs is inevitable and necessary. We believe that Aramchol with its unique, first-in-class MoA is a perfect drug candidate to be combined with other MASH drugs, approved or in development.
Galmed is currently working on a new sublingual (SL) formulation of Aramchol which will allow the development of a fixed dose combination of Aramchol with an approved metabolic agent. The successful development of this formulation would allow Galmed to move towards promptly initiating a Phase 2 MASH clinical study.
Aramchol for Gastrointestinal (GI) oncology indications
As we announced in mid-November, early findings from our pre-clinical combination studies of Aramchol with Stivarga® (Bayer) and metformin in GI tumor models demonstrated that Aramchol enhances the activity and potentially overcomes regorafenib's (a standard-of-care treatments for many GI Cancers) drug resistance.
These results support our plans to advance Aramchol into a Phase 1/2 clinical trial for metastatic colorectal cancer (CRC), hepatocellular carcinoma (HCC), and cholangiocarcinoma in collaboration with VCU Massey Comprehensive Cancer Center in early 2026.
Based on this approach, we are currently conducting multiple pre-clinical studies with Aramchol to overcome drug resistance and enhance the efficacy of other standard-of-care (SoC) oncology agents for cancer treatment with unmet needs. We believe the successful completion of our Phase 1/2 clinical trial of Aramchol and Stivarga®, will enable the initiation of similar clinical studies with other SoC agents for additional oncology indications.
We view this strategy (particularly in the case of rare cancer indications) as the fastest pathway for FDA approval of Aramchol and initiation of commercialization.
Expansion Potential Beyond MASH and Oncology
The identification of a unique panel of systemic blood-based biomarkers including inflammation, oxidative stress, and cardiac-related parameters such as atrial natriuretic peptide (ANP) (which we announced earlier this year) not only confirms Aramchol's on-target biological activity but also broadens Aramchol's potential clinical utility and disease-modifying capabilities in cardiometabolic diseases, systemic inflammation, and broader metabolic-cardiovascular indications.
in order to be able to benefit from Aramchol's multi-system therapeutic potential, well beyond its initial liver-focused applications, higher exposure of Aramchol in the blood is needed. We are developing a novel, proprietary, subcutaneous (SC) formulation for Aramchol to be able to bring higher quantities of Aramchol to the target organs, and particularly to the heart.
The successful development of such formulation is expected to present Galmed with an exciting opportunity to enhance clinical decision-making and expand into additional disease areas with significant market potential.
